Click-N-Type virtual keyboard (on-screen keyboard) free software is an assistive technology for people with a physical disability involving motor skill impairment from spinal cord injuries, ALS, Muscular Dystrophy, Cerebral Palsy, Multiple Sclerosis…

SpeedCrunch. SpeedCrunch is a high-precision scientific calculator featuring a fast, keyboard-driven user interface. It is free and open-source software, licensed under the GPL. Download Documentation Donate .
